Today, our Town Council went about their job of fogging… For those that do not know what this is, this is regular “fogging” with chemical insecticides to exterminate adult mosquitoes, hence, control dengue in Singapore.
These “Mozzie Busters” fog in the local surrounding area, in the rubbish chutes or wherever there may be a mosquito breeding site… Why do I have this love-hate relationship?
